This Grug really skeptical of Orca, 10 big cost and sentries scary when Kit not help you out. (Unless very lucky double spark)

Engolo still good clean simple card, let you run in servers with 2 ice without worry. Also very good to draw and install.

Grug also switch from Prepaid VoicePAD to Telework. Click Telework simple, value off Prepaid not simple.

Grug also very like Trick Shot, grug can play trickshot any time to pressure corp and usually goes well.

However, this Grug no like playing against nasty Jinteki decks, they make Kit ability sad and have too much big ice for simple Grug money.

Grug also no understand how to Cataloguer, Grug think one guaranteed to hit agenda when using Cataloguer 3 times. But apparently not. Is this Jnet bug?

Because Jinteki and bug, Grug go 1-2 at AMT, but Corp did good.
